Lots of things were talked about last night. Main points were.....
On Hardaker...DP explained that because it happened so late in the season, it left it difficult to bring in a replacement as most players (especially those from Down Under) had already been signed up. He did get asked if there was money to use should a player he feels could improve us become available and the answer was yes. DP also said that ZH hasn't even had his hearing yet. Those other rumours are just that and nothing in them.
On the start so far... All of the Coaches commented that the WC had set our pre-season back by about 3 weeks and that they were bringing the players upto match speed as quickly as possible and have some players on individual routines. They acknowledged that the St.Helens game wasn't good enough but that the Widnes game was a step in the right direction, although the conditions and state of the pitches atm aren't helping either with the way we like to play.
On missing out on a WCC match...DP says he wasn't too disappointed on not having the secondary World Club Challenge game because he wants the main one. Asked about Wigan/Hull's excursion to Australia, he felt it wouldn't benefit either team in the long run this season because of the demands it places on their squads. ( Hull have already picked-up some notable injuries and they still have another match to play before meeting us).
On the England job...he said it was a non-goer.
On someone else playing Fullback for us from within our squad... He said because the position is so important to us with the way we play, there is no-one he feels could do the job as he wants. Hitchcox he sees primarily as a winger and young Turner just isn't ready yet. Someone mentioned Walker at Leeds and DP said that we play FB much differently to how they do.
On the 5k handed over by the CTSC....its going to be used on new Data Analyst software and a new cable gym machine.
